[發(fā)明專利]一種可擴(kuò)展的鉆井業(yè)務(wù)數(shù)據(jù)交換系統(tǒng)與方法有效
| 申請(qǐng)?zhí)枺?/td> | 201711055352.7 | 申請(qǐng)日: | 2017-11-01 |
| 公開(公告)號(hào): | CN109753270B | 公開(公告)日: | 2022-05-20 |
| 發(fā)明(設(shè)計(jì))人: | 何江;孫旭東;謝關(guān)寶;鄒本友;段繼男;方春飛;王果;王玉娟 | 申請(qǐng)(專利權(quán))人: | 中國(guó)石油化工股份有限公司;中國(guó)石油化工股份有限公司石油工程技術(shù)研究院 |
| 主分類號(hào): | G06F8/20 | 分類號(hào): | G06F8/20;G06F8/41;H04L49/10 |
| 代理公司: | 北京聿華聯(lián)合知識(shí)產(chǎn)權(quán)代理有限公司 11611 | 代理人: | 張文娟;朱繪 |
| 地址: | 100728 北*** | 國(guó)省代碼: | 北京;11 |
| 權(quán)利要求書: | 查看更多 | 說(shuō)明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 擴(kuò)展 鉆井 業(yè)務(wù) 數(shù)據(jù) 交換 系統(tǒng) 方法 | ||
1.一種可擴(kuò)展的鉆井業(yè)務(wù)數(shù)據(jù)交換系統(tǒng),其特征在于,該系統(tǒng)為用于實(shí)現(xiàn)鉆井業(yè)務(wù)各工作站點(diǎn)之間的交換和共享,所述系統(tǒng)具備若干個(gè)具有數(shù)據(jù)發(fā)送功能和數(shù)據(jù)接收功能的數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n),每個(gè)數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n)具備鉆井業(yè)務(wù)實(shí)體類庫(kù),所述鉆井業(yè)務(wù)實(shí)體類庫(kù)具備預(yù)設(shè)的若干套鉆井業(yè)務(wù)實(shí)體類,每種類型的鉆井業(yè)務(wù)數(shù)據(jù)對(duì)應(yīng)一套鉆井業(yè)務(wù)實(shí)體類,所述鉆井業(yè)務(wù)實(shí)體類是對(duì)應(yīng)于鉆井業(yè)務(wù)數(shù)據(jù)類型的一種程序類,在所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n)執(zhí)行發(fā)送操作時(shí)稱為數(shù)據(jù)發(fā)送節(jié)點(diǎn),在所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n)執(zhí)行接收操作時(shí)稱為數(shù)據(jù)接收節(jié)點(diǎn),進(jìn)一步,
所述數(shù)據(jù)發(fā)送節(jié)點(diǎn),其按照預(yù)設(shè)的鉆井業(yè)務(wù)實(shí)體類,利用針對(duì)若干套所述鉆井業(yè)務(wù)實(shí)體類的編碼方案,將需要交換的鉆井業(yè)務(wù)數(shù)據(jù)進(jìn)行編碼處理后,經(jīng)數(shù)據(jù)網(wǎng)絡(luò)傳輸至需要接收交換數(shù)據(jù)的另一所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n)中,所述鉆井業(yè)務(wù)實(shí)體類為基于所述鉆井業(yè)務(wù)數(shù)據(jù)的內(nèi)容屬性構(gòu)建的關(guān)于所述鉆井業(yè)務(wù)數(shù)據(jù)的實(shí)體類;
所述數(shù)據(jù)接收節(jié)點(diǎn),其利用針對(duì)若干套所述鉆井業(yè)務(wù)實(shí)體類的解碼方案,對(duì)編碼后的處理結(jié)果進(jìn)行解編處理,再按照所述鉆井業(yè)務(wù)實(shí)體類的定義,將解編處理結(jié)果轉(zhuǎn)換成鉆井業(yè)務(wù)數(shù)據(jù),實(shí)現(xiàn)數(shù)據(jù)交換功能,其中,所有所述鉆井業(yè)務(wù)實(shí)體類繼承自預(yù)設(shè)的同一基類,其中,
所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n),其還基于新種類的所述鉆井業(yè)務(wù)數(shù)據(jù)的內(nèi)容屬性,構(gòu)建鉆井業(yè)務(wù)新實(shí)體類,并將所述鉆井業(yè)務(wù)新實(shí)體類添加至所有所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n),其中,所述鉆井業(yè)務(wù)新實(shí)體類以新類型的所述鉆井業(yè)務(wù)數(shù)據(jù)的屬性進(jìn)行定義,并繼承自同一基類,所述鉆井業(yè)務(wù)實(shí)體類的實(shí)例經(jīng)同一套處理方案進(jìn)行序列化和反序列化處理。
2.根據(jù)權(quán)利要求1所述的系統(tǒng),其特征在于,所述數(shù)據(jù)發(fā)送節(jié)點(diǎn),進(jìn)一步包括:
數(shù)據(jù)寫入單元,其調(diào)取需要交換的包含具體數(shù)據(jù)的所述鉆井業(yè)務(wù)數(shù)據(jù),將所述鉆井業(yè)務(wù)數(shù)據(jù)中的具體數(shù)據(jù)作為屬性值寫入對(duì)應(yīng)類型的所述鉆井業(yè)務(wù)實(shí)體類中,建立針對(duì)所述鉆井業(yè)務(wù)數(shù)據(jù)的實(shí)例;
數(shù)據(jù)編碼單元,其利用對(duì)應(yīng)類型的所述鉆井業(yè)務(wù)實(shí)體類的定義,將寫入屬性值后的所述鉆井業(yè)務(wù)實(shí)體類的實(shí)例采用序列化處理方式進(jìn)行編碼,得到相應(yīng)的業(yè)務(wù)序列化數(shù)據(jù)。
3.根據(jù)權(quán)利要求1或2所述的系統(tǒng),其特征在于,所述數(shù)據(jù)接收節(jié)點(diǎn),其進(jìn)一步具備:
數(shù)據(jù)解編單元,其接收另一具有發(fā)送功能的所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n)輸出的業(yè)務(wù)序列化數(shù)據(jù),將所述業(yè)務(wù)序列化數(shù)據(jù)采用反序列化處理方式進(jìn)行解編,利用對(duì)應(yīng)類型的所述鉆井業(yè)務(wù)實(shí)體類的定義,將反序列化處理結(jié)果轉(zhuǎn)換成相應(yīng)的所述鉆井業(yè)務(wù)實(shí)體類的實(shí)例。
4.根據(jù)權(quán)利要求3所述的系統(tǒng),其特征在于,所述數(shù)據(jù)接收節(jié)點(diǎn),其進(jìn)一步具備:
數(shù)據(jù)讀取單元,其進(jìn)一步利用所述鉆井業(yè)務(wù)數(shù)據(jù)所屬數(shù)據(jù)類型的屬性,從同一所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n)中的所述數(shù)據(jù)解編單元輸出的所述鉆井業(yè)務(wù)實(shí)體類的實(shí)例中,讀取相應(yīng)的業(yè)務(wù)數(shù)據(jù)的屬性值,得到包含具體數(shù)據(jù)的所述鉆井業(yè)務(wù)數(shù)據(jù),完成數(shù)據(jù)交換。
5.一種可擴(kuò)展的鉆井業(yè)務(wù)數(shù)據(jù)交換方法,該方法應(yīng)用于如權(quán)利要求1~4中任一項(xiàng)所述的數(shù)據(jù)交換系統(tǒng),其特征在于,該方法包括如下步驟:
業(yè)務(wù)數(shù)據(jù)發(fā)送步驟:構(gòu)建所述鉆井業(yè)務(wù)實(shí)體類,利用針對(duì)所述鉆井業(yè)務(wù)實(shí)體類的所述編碼方案,將需要交換的所述鉆井業(yè)務(wù)數(shù)據(jù)進(jìn)行編碼處理后,經(jīng)數(shù)據(jù)網(wǎng)絡(luò)傳輸至需要接收交換數(shù)據(jù)的另一所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n);
業(yè)務(wù)數(shù)據(jù)交換步驟:利用針對(duì)所述鉆井業(yè)務(wù)實(shí)體類的所述解碼方案,對(duì)編碼后的處理結(jié)果進(jìn)行解編處理,再按照所述鉆井業(yè)務(wù)實(shí)體類的定義,將解編處理結(jié)果轉(zhuǎn)換成所述鉆井業(yè)務(wù)數(shù)據(jù),實(shí)現(xiàn)數(shù)據(jù)交換功能,其中,所有所述鉆井業(yè)務(wù)實(shí)體類繼承自預(yù)設(shè)的同一基類;
業(yè)務(wù)數(shù)據(jù)擴(kuò)展步驟:基于新種類的所述鉆井業(yè)務(wù)數(shù)據(jù)的屬性,構(gòu)建鉆井業(yè)務(wù)新實(shí)體類,并將所述鉆井業(yè)務(wù)新實(shí)體類添加至所有所述數(shù)據(jù)處理網(wǎng)絡(luò)節(jié)點(diǎn)中,其中,所述鉆井業(yè)務(wù)新實(shí)體類繼承自同一基類,所述鉆井業(yè)務(wù)實(shí)體類的實(shí)例經(jīng)同一套處理方案進(jìn)行序列化和反序列化處理。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于中國(guó)石油化工股份有限公司;中國(guó)石油化工股份有限公司石油工程技術(shù)研究院,未經(jīng)中國(guó)石油化工股份有限公司;中國(guó)石油化工股份有限公司石油工程技術(shù)研究院許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201711055352.7/1.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專利網(wǎng)。
- 一種在有線智能網(wǎng)中實(shí)現(xiàn)直播業(yè)務(wù)的方法
- 業(yè)務(wù)路由方法、業(yè)務(wù)路由器、客戶端設(shè)備及業(yè)務(wù)網(wǎng)絡(luò)系統(tǒng)
- 一種移動(dòng)業(yè)務(wù)消息路由的方法、系統(tǒng)和設(shè)備
- 業(yè)務(wù)處理方法、設(shè)備和系統(tǒng)
- 業(yè)務(wù)編排方法及裝置、業(yè)務(wù)發(fā)放方法及裝置
- 業(yè)務(wù)限流方法及業(yè)務(wù)限流裝置
- 一種信息推薦方法、裝置及存儲(chǔ)介質(zhì)
- 一種基于業(yè)務(wù)事件的頁(yè)面展示方法、裝置和電子設(shè)備
- 業(yè)務(wù)編排方法及裝置、業(yè)務(wù)發(fā)放方法及裝置
- 一種安全業(yè)務(wù)的定義、開發(fā)和執(zhí)行方法及系統(tǒng)
- 數(shù)據(jù)顯示系統(tǒng)、數(shù)據(jù)中繼設(shè)備、數(shù)據(jù)中繼方法、數(shù)據(jù)系統(tǒng)、接收設(shè)備和數(shù)據(jù)讀取方法
- 數(shù)據(jù)記錄方法、數(shù)據(jù)記錄裝置、數(shù)據(jù)記錄媒體、數(shù)據(jù)重播方法和數(shù)據(jù)重播裝置
- 數(shù)據(jù)發(fā)送方法、數(shù)據(jù)發(fā)送系統(tǒng)、數(shù)據(jù)發(fā)送裝置以及數(shù)據(jù)結(jié)構(gòu)
- 數(shù)據(jù)顯示系統(tǒng)、數(shù)據(jù)中繼設(shè)備、數(shù)據(jù)中繼方法及數(shù)據(jù)系統(tǒng)
- 數(shù)據(jù)嵌入裝置、數(shù)據(jù)嵌入方法、數(shù)據(jù)提取裝置及數(shù)據(jù)提取方法
- 數(shù)據(jù)管理裝置、數(shù)據(jù)編輯裝置、數(shù)據(jù)閱覽裝置、數(shù)據(jù)管理方法、數(shù)據(jù)編輯方法以及數(shù)據(jù)閱覽方法
- 數(shù)據(jù)發(fā)送和數(shù)據(jù)接收設(shè)備、數(shù)據(jù)發(fā)送和數(shù)據(jù)接收方法
- 數(shù)據(jù)發(fā)送裝置、數(shù)據(jù)接收裝置、數(shù)據(jù)收發(fā)系統(tǒng)、數(shù)據(jù)發(fā)送方法、數(shù)據(jù)接收方法和數(shù)據(jù)收發(fā)方法
- 數(shù)據(jù)發(fā)送方法、數(shù)據(jù)再現(xiàn)方法、數(shù)據(jù)發(fā)送裝置及數(shù)據(jù)再現(xiàn)裝置
- 數(shù)據(jù)發(fā)送方法、數(shù)據(jù)再現(xiàn)方法、數(shù)據(jù)發(fā)送裝置及數(shù)據(jù)再現(xiàn)裝置





